i
Perficient
Filter interviews by
Tools used for data engineering include ETL tools, programming languages, databases, and cloud platforms.
ETL tools like Apache NiFi, Talend, and Informatica are used for data extraction, transformation, and loading.
Programming languages like Python, Java, and Scala are used for data processing and analysis.
Databases like MySQL, PostgreSQL, and MongoDB are used for storing and managing data.
Cloud platforms like AWS, Azu...
Blockers faced while working as a Data Engineer
Lack of proper documentation
Inadequate infrastructure
Data quality issues
Limited access to necessary data sources
Inefficient data processing pipelines
I applied via Campus Placement and was interviewed before May 2023. There was 1 interview round.
I appeared for an interview in Aug 2024.
Use the DISTINCT keyword in a SELECT statement to remove duplicate rows from a table.
Use the DISTINCT keyword in a SELECT statement to retrieve unique rows
Use the GROUP BY clause with appropriate columns to remove duplicates
Use the ROW_NUMBER() function to assign a unique row number to each row and then filter out rows with row number greater than 1
I applied via Approached by Company and was interviewed in Apr 2024. There was 1 interview round.
SQL and python questions are very easy.
I appeared for an interview in Aug 2024.
Hadoop is an open-source framework used for distributed storage and processing of large data sets across clusters of computers.
Hadoop consists of HDFS (Hadoop Distributed File System) for storage and MapReduce for processing.
It allows for parallel processing of large datasets across multiple nodes in a cluster.
Hadoop is scalable, fault-tolerant, and cost-effective for handling big data.
Popular tools like Apache Hive, A...
I applied via Campus Placement and was interviewed before Sep 2023. There were 3 interview rounds.
It was an on campus recruitment drive with questions mostly on basic statistics and algebra.
In round 2 the interviewer asked to explain one of my project and then write code for longest common substring problem.
One Simple coding problem followed with couple of probability questions and explaining the Simple Linear model in detail.
I appeared for an interview before Dec 2023.
Aptitude test had questions like upstream, downstream, etc
SQL questions and 2 live python coding questions
It was good and comparatively moderate.
Indexing in SQL is a technique to improve the performance of queries by creating a data structure that allows for faster retrieval of data.
Indexes are created on columns in a database table to speed up the retrieval of data.
They work similar to the index in a book, allowing the database to quickly find the rows that match a certain value.
Indexes can be created using single or multiple columns.
Examples: CREATE INDEX ind
I applied via Campus Placement and was interviewed in Dec 2024. There were 4 interview rounds.
Two coding questions related to matrices and heaps.
based on 2 interviews
Interview experience
based on 7 reviews
Rating in categories
Technical Consultant
860
salaries
| ₹4.2 L/yr - ₹14.9 L/yr |
Senior Technical Consultant
440
salaries
| ₹7.1 L/yr - ₹22 L/yr |
Associate Technical Consultant
324
salaries
| ₹3.3 L/yr - ₹8.5 L/yr |
Technical Leader Consultant
222
salaries
| ₹11.2 L/yr - ₹29 L/yr |
Softwaretest Engineer
189
salaries
| ₹4.1 L/yr - ₹9 L/yr |
Xoriant
Photon Interactive
CitiusTech
Iris Software